1. A system comprising:

  • a pump for connecting to a fluid source for transporting fluid;

    an adjustable-speed drive coupled with the pump for driving the pump at a plurality of pumping rates;

    a flow meter coupled with the pump for determining an approximately instantaneous pumping rate of the pump;

    a processor coupled with the adjustable-speed drive and the flow meter for receiving an approximately instantaneous power consumption and an approximately instantaneous pumping rate, the processor configured to control the adjustable speed drive to selectively operate the pump at a pumping rate selected from the plurality of pumping rates; and

    control programming configured to associate a first approximately instantaneous pumping rate with a first approximately instantaneous power consumption for a first time interval, and to associate a second approximately instantaneous pumping rate with a second approximately instantaneous power consumption for a second time interval, the control programming configured to select an optimal pumping rate for operating the pump based upon the comparison of a first metric determined from the first approximately instantaneous pumping rate and the first approximately instantaneous power consumption and a second metric determined from the second approximately instantaneous pumping rate and the second approximately instantaneous power consumption;

    wherein the control programming is configured to start the pump at least approximately at ninety percent (90%) of full speed.
